Yes, length, that is for a 12 metre boat. Many costs on a narrowboat are determined by length, licence, cost of blacking, insurance etc. The Medway is more geared towards grp cruisers than narrowboats, grp boats tend to be much shorter.
I personally wouldn't travel to or from the main network from the Medway on my own, or on anything other than the calmest day. narrowboats are designed to float in muddy ditches four feet deep, not tidal estuaries.
